百度用什么编程技术实现

不及物动词 其他 21

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    百度使用了多种编程技术来实现其各项功能。以下是其中几种常见的编程技术:

    1. Python:百度在后端开发中广泛使用Python编程语言。Python具有简洁、易读、易学的特点,适合用于快速开发和迭代。百度利用Python来处理数据、构建算法、实现爬虫等。

    2. C++:C++是一种高效的编程语言,广泛应用于百度的底层开发和性能优化。百度使用C++来实现搜索引擎的核心算法、网络通信、大规模数据处理等。

    3. Java:Java是一种跨平台的编程语言,百度在后端服务开发中经常使用Java。Java具有丰富的类库和强大的生态系统,适用于构建复杂的分布式系统。

    4. JavaScript:JavaScript是一种脚本语言,被广泛用于网页前端开发。百度利用JavaScript来实现网页交互、动态效果、数据可视化等。

    5. Hadoop:Hadoop是一个开源的分布式计算框架,百度利用Hadoop来处理大规模的数据。通过Hadoop,百度可以快速、高效地处理和分析海量数据。

    6. TensorFlow:TensorFlow是一个开源的机器学习框架,百度使用TensorFlow来构建和训练深度学习模型。通过TensorFlow,百度可以实现图像识别、语音识别、自然语言处理等人工智能技术。

    除了以上几种编程技术,百度还使用了其他各种技术来实现其各项功能,如数据库技术、网络协议、分布式系统等。总之,百度在技术上持续创新,不断探索和采用适合自身需求的编程技术来提供更好的服务。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    百度使用了多种编程技术来实现其各种产品和服务。以下是百度主要使用的编程技术:

    1. Java:百度的大部分后端服务都是使用Java编写的。Java是一种广泛使用的编程语言,具有良好的可移植性和跨平台性,适合用于构建大规模的分布式系统。百度的核心搜索引擎、广告系统、地图服务等都是使用Java编写的。

    2. C++:C++是一种高效的编程语言,适合用于编写底层系统和高性能的应用程序。百度在一些对性能要求较高的场景中使用C++编写,例如图像处理、机器学习等方面。

    3. Python:百度也广泛使用Python编程语言。Python是一种简单易学的编程语言,具有丰富的库和框架,适合用于快速开发和原型验证。百度在数据分析、人工智能等领域使用Python进行开发。

    4. JavaScript:JavaScript是一种脚本语言,主要用于前端开发。百度的网页和移动应用程序都使用JavaScript来实现交互和动态效果。此外,百度还使用Node.js这个基于JavaScript的运行时环境来构建后端服务。

    5. Hadoop和Spark:Hadoop和Spark是两个大数据处理框架,百度使用它们来处理和分析大规模的数据。Hadoop提供了分布式存储和计算能力,而Spark则提供了更高级的数据处理和分析功能。

    除了以上列举的编程技术外,百度还使用了其他一些技术和工具,如HTML/CSS、SQL、Shell脚本、Git等。这些技术和工具共同构成了百度丰富多样的产品和服务的基础。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    百度使用多种编程技术来实现其各种产品和服务。以下是一些常见的编程技术和工具,百度在开发过程中可能会使用的。

    1. Java:Java 是百度最常用的编程语言之一。百度的核心系统和服务,如搜索引擎、广告系统、地图、音乐等都是用 Java 编写的。Java 是一种跨平台的编程语言,它的稳定性和性能使它成为百度开发的首选之一。

    2. C++:C++ 是另一种百度常用的编程语言。C++ 可以提供更高的性能和更好的内存管理,适用于一些对性能要求较高的系统和服务,如图像处理、机器学习和大数据处理等。

    3. Python:Python 是一种简单易用且功能强大的编程语言,百度在机器学习、自然语言处理和数据分析等领域广泛使用 Python。Python 有丰富的库和框架,如 TensorFlow、PyTorch 和 Pandas,使开发人员能够更轻松地实现复杂的功能。

    4. JavaScript:JavaScript 是一种用于前端开发的脚本语言,百度的网页应用和移动应用都会使用 JavaScript 来实现交互和动态效果。百度还开发了自己的 JavaScript 框架,如百度 EUI 和百度地图 API。

    5. Hadoop:Hadoop 是一个开源的分布式计算框架,百度使用 Hadoop 来处理和分析大规模的数据。Hadoop 提供了可扩展的存储和计算能力,使百度能够有效地处理海量的数据。

    6. Spark:Spark 是一个快速、通用的大数据处理引擎,百度在大数据分析和机器学习中使用 Spark 来进行数据处理和计算。Spark 提供了丰富的 API 和内置的机器学习库,使开发人员能够更高效地进行数据分析和建模。

    7. TensorFlow:TensorFlow 是一个开源的机器学习框架,百度在深度学习和人工智能领域使用 TensorFlow 来构建和训练模型。TensorFlow 提供了丰富的工具和库,使开发人员能够更轻松地实现各种机器学习算法和模型。

    除了上述的编程技术,百度还使用了其他一些工具和技术来提高开发效率和产品质量,如版本控制系统(如 Git)、持续集成和部署工具(如 Jenkins)、自动化测试框架和性能优化工具等。这些工具和技术有助于百度开发人员更高效地开发和维护产品,并确保产品的质量和稳定性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部